Web前端培训:前端开发的最佳实践

Web前端培训:前端开发的最佳实践

在当今这个信息化的时代,Web前端开发已经成为了一个非常热门的职业,越来越多的人选择学习Web前端开发,希望能够在这个领域取得成功,如何才能成为一名优秀的Web前端开发者呢?本文将为您提供一些关于前端开发的最佳实践,帮助您快速提升自己的技能水平。

Web前端培训:前端开发的最佳实践

1、熟练掌握HTML、CSS和JavaScript

HTML(超文本标记语言)是Web前端开发的基础,它用于定义网页的结构,CSS(层叠样式表)用于控制网页的样式,让网页更加美观,JavaScript是一种编程语言,用于实现网页的交互功能,熟练掌握这三种技术,是成为一名优秀Web前端开发者的必备条件。

2、学会使用前端框架和库

前端框架和库可以帮助我们更高效地开发Web应用,常见的前端框架有React、Vue和Angular,它们都有自己的特点和优势,学会使用这些框架和库,可以让我们的开发效率大大提高。

3、注重代码质量和可维护性

在编写代码时,我们应该注重代码的质量和可维护性,代码质量高意味着程序运行速度快、出错率低;代码可维护性强意味着程序易于修改、扩展和升级,我们应该遵循一定的编码规范,编写简洁、易懂的代码。

4、学会优化性能

为了提高Web应用的用户体验,我们需要关注程序的性能,在开发过程中,我们可以通过以下几种方式来优化性能:减少HTTP请求、压缩图片和CSS文件、使用CDN加速等。

Web前端培训:前端开发的最佳实践

5、了解浏览器兼容性和响应式设计

浏览器兼容性是一个非常重要的问题,在开发Web应用时,我们需要确保程序能够在不同的浏览器中正常运行,响应式设计是一种让网页能够适应不同设备屏幕尺寸的技术,它可以提高Web应用的可用性和用户体验。

6、学会使用版本控制工具

版本控制工具可以帮助我们更好地管理代码,常见的版本控制工具有Git和SVN,学会使用这些工具,可以让我们更方便地进行团队协作和代码管理。

7、关注行业动态和技术发展

作为一名Web前端开发者,我们应该关注行业的动态和技术发展,这可以帮助我们了解最新的技术和趋势,从而不断提升自己的技能水平。

问题与解答:

1、如何解决浏览器兼容性问题?

Web前端培训:前端开发的最佳实践

答:可以使用Polyfill技术来解决部分浏览器兼容性问题;或者使用CSS Reset或Normalize.css等工具来重置浏览器的默认样式;还可以使用Autoprefixer插件来自动添加浏览器前缀。

2、如何提高网站的加载速度?

答:可以使用图片压缩工具来减小图片体积;使用CSS Sprites技术来合并图片;使用CDN加速来分发静态资源;合理使用缓存策略等。

3、如何实现移动端适配?

答:可以使用响应式设计技术来实现移动端适配;或者使用Bootstrap等前端框架来快速搭建移动端页面;还可以使用PWA(Progressive Web App)技术来构建原生App体验的Web应用。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/133876.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-16 09:57
Next 2023-12-16 10:03

相关推荐

  • html css制作静态网页-html+css静态网页题下载

    大家好!小编今天给大家解答一下有关html+css静态网页题下载,以及分享几个html css制作静态网页对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。...至少五个页面。要求用的代码是html+div+css去开创者素材下载几个差不多的模板,自己改改里面的文字就行了,学校的网页要求不高,那里的模板满足要求了。这就是一个class选择器,意思是有一种CSS的样式,其名字是alsp,谁想用谁用。

    2023-11-23
    0138
  • css滚动显示文字

    各位朋友,大家好!小编整理了有关html5css3数字滚动的解答,顺便拓展几个相关知识点,希望能解决你的问题,我们现在开始阅读吧!学习web前端需具备哪些技能服务器端编程:学习服务器端编程知识,如Node.js,以便可以编写服务器端脚本和API。数据库知识:学习数据库知识,如SQL语言,以便于处理和存储数据。Web前端开发需要学习的知识包括但不限于以下几个方面:HTML、CSS、JavaScript:这是Web前端开发的基础,需要掌握HTML标记语言、CSS样式表以及JavaScript脚本语言的基本语法和常用特性。

    2023-12-14
    0122
  • html怎么响应式不变形_css如何响应式布局

    各位访客大家好!今天小编关注到一个比较有意思的话题,就是关于html怎么响应式不变形的问题,于是小编就整理了几个相关介绍的解答,让我们一起看看吧,希望对你有帮助网页设计中响应式具体怎么实现?1、适当调整图片格式图片格式的选择也直接影响了网页响应式设计的效果,通常来说,JPEG格式的图片比PNG格式的图片加载更快。但如果图片需要透明度,那么PNG格式的图片就会更加合适。

    2023-12-06
    0140
  • web前端培训:6种基本的前端编程语言是什么

    HTMLHTML(超文本标记语言)是Web前端开发的基础,它是一种用于创建网页的标记语言,HTML文件是由一系列的标签组成的,这些标签用于描述网页的内容和结构,HTML标签包括:标题、段落、链接、图片、列表等,通过使用这些标签,我们可以轻松地创建出美观且具有交互性的网页。CSSCSS(层叠样式表)是一种用于描述网页样式的语言,它可以将……

    2023-12-15
    0122
  • htmlcss的优点_htmlcssjs

    各位朋友,大家好!小编整理了有关htmlcss的优点的解答,顺便拓展几个相关知识点,希望能解决你的问题,我们现在开始阅读吧!简述网页中CSS的优点使用较少的代码,来实现更多的功能;使用属性继承方法,可以轻松地维护相同标记的不同样式;代码比率更高的内容;页面加载变得很快;定义风格的灵活性。易于使用和修改。CSS 能够对网页中元素位置的排版进行像素级精确控制,支持几乎所有的字体字号样式,拥有对网页对象和模型样式编辑的能力。多页面应用。利用它可以实现修改一个小的样式更新与之相关的所有页面元素。层叠。

    2023-12-09
    0145
  • Web前端培训:Angular中的Resolver概述

    Web前端培训:Angular中的Resolver概述在Angular中,Resolver是一个非常重要的概念,它是一个接口,用于在运行时解析和注入依赖项,Resolver的主要作用是在组件实例化之前,将所需的依赖项注入到组件的构造函数中,这样可以确保组件在创建时具有所需的所有依赖项,从而避免了潜在的错误和不一致性。Resolver的……

    2023-12-16
    0127

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入